so my transparent test tint wore off after couple months....so i bought a can of VHT night shade and attempt to re-tint it. but i totally miscalculate it and it turned out too dark like this:
before:
![](http://memimage.cardomain.net/member_images/11/web/287000-287999/287618_272_full.jpg)
after:
![](http://home.comcast.net/~happyricefob/tail.jpg)
i don't really like it cuz it's way too dark during the day. i wouldn't mind at night...but i'm thinking just going back to stock tails and red-out the amber part. the problem is...VHT night shade's coating is unremovable. what do you guys think i should do?

Elbow grease, terry cloth towel, finger nail polish remover (ie acetone) = removed. Acetone will not cloud the plastic. It takes quite a bit of rubbing to get the paint though. I've done this numerous times when changing my smoked lens setup.
